M9 개발블로그

  • 홈

화살표함수 this 1

화살표 함수 this(arrow function this)

자바스크립트에서 this는 보통 함수를 호출한 주체가 무엇인지에 따라 결정된다. 그리고 함수는 보통 자신만의 this를 갖고 있다. 하지만 화살표 함수만큼은 기존의 this와 다른 점이 있다. 그래서 일반 함수와 화살표 함수에서 this의 다른 점이 무엇인지 정리해보겠다. 화살표 함수는 부모의 this를 받아온다. 일반 함수는 함수를 호출한 주체 또는 자신의 this(즉, 자신을 포함하고 있는 주체. 여기서는 return으로 반환된 객체)를 갖는다. 그래서 일반 함수를 사용하며 부모의 this를 받아오기 위해서 종종 bind 메서드를 활용하게 된다. 하지만 화살표 함수는 부모의 this를 받아오기 위해 bind를 할 필요가 없다. 왜냐하면 이미 부모의 this를 받아오는 것이 화살표 함수이기 때문이다. ..

Javascript 2020.11.11
이전
1
다음
더보기
프로필사진

M9 개발블로그

개발 기본기 다지기

  • 분류 전체보기 (27)
    • Backend (0)
    • Front-End (5)
      • html (1)
      • css (3)
    • Javascript (6)
    • MySQL (6)
    • Linux (0)
    • 깃, 깃허브 (1)
    • 자료구조 및 알고리즘 (2)
    • Java (5)
    • 네트워크 (1)

Tag

css display none, javascript, The Document Object Model, css display inline-block, arrow function this, inline block 차이, mysql 기본키, css position relative, 문서 객체 모델, JavaScript HTML 조작, css display block, this, 화살표함수 this, JavaScript HTML 접근, MySQL, css position static, 자바스크립트, css position sticky, inline과 block, css display inline,

최근글과 인기글

  • 최근글
  • 인기글

최근댓글

공지사항

페이스북 트위터 플러그인

  • Facebook
  • Twitter

Archives

Calendar

«   2025/05   »
일 월 화 수 목 금 토
1 2 3
4 5 6 7 8 9 10
11 12 13 14 15 16 17
18 19 20 21 22 23 24
25 26 27 28 29 30 31

방문자수Total

  • Today :
  • Yesterday :

Copyright © Kakao Corp. All rights reserved.

티스토리툴바